Job Description

Job Purpose

Own the end to end planning function, synchronising supply and demand to deliver best-in-class outcomes across channels and categories. Through effective leadership and cross-functional collaboration, drive superior product availability while optimising inventory and working capital.


Key Position Accountabilities


Strategy, Governance & Leadership

  • Define and govern the end-to-end supply chain planning strategy aligned to business objectives (growth, service, working capital)
  • Own, chair, and mature the S&OP/IBP cadence, ensuring one aligned plan across Demand, Supply, and Finance
  • Optimise inventory strategy aimed at delivering improved service level to all channels whilst minimising working capital
  • Align at the channel level to drive integrated planning through ranging and replenishment strategy
  • Drive continuous improvement of planning processes, data governance, and systems adoption


Performance & Financial Outcomes

  • Own planning impact on P&L drivers: service levels, inventory investment, write-offs/obsolescence, working capital, KPI’s, etc.
  • Lead annual/quarterly planning targets and risk mitigation plans for inventory and availability
  • Partner with Finance to translate plans into financial outlooks and scenario options


Stakeholder Partnership

  • Build strong collaboration with Commercial/Category / Channel leaders to align priorities, promotions, and assortment changes with supply capability, whilst also holding them to account
  • Ensure clear governance across channels with agreed service targets and inventory policies
  • Enable cross-functional collaboration and fast resolution of planning execution blockers
